Simulation And Research On Integral Fracturing Of Coal Seam

Integral fracturing is an important technical means of conventional reservoir development, it was already more mature; but coal and coalbed methane development had their own characteristics, integral fracturing technology of conventional reservoir couldn’t be applicable to coalbed methane development overally, the problem of simulation of integral fracturing in coal and program development and the matching of artificial fracture and well network of development were difficult problems what plagued the exploration and development of coalbed methane in long-term.This thesis based on the basic theory of fracture, combined the geological features of seam fracturing, based on the results of microseismic fracture monitoring and inclinometer, comprehensive determined that the fracture of coal seam formed by hydraulic fracturing were fractures of network, it also counted the general size of hydraulic fracture of the coal seam fracturing and the basic conditions for forming the size of fracture have been given.A seam fracturing simulation model was researched in this thesis, and the software system was be completed, it was applied to simulation the fracture’s length and height of 4 wells and 5 coal seams, the simulation results had a higher degree agreement with the results of micro-seismic monitoring and inclinometer, and it satisfied the requirerments of the field of engineering application.Based on the mechanism of coal seam seepage, under the conditions with artificial cracks, a numerical simulation model of coalbed methane reservoirs was researched in this thesis, the model included the vapor pressure equation and saturation equation and the aqueous phase pressure equation and saturation equation, numerical simulation model had been calculated; Also, the coal seam fracturing simulation model was also founded and completed the corresponding calculation.It analysed the effects of coal seam parameters, fracturing parameters and production parameters on the coal seam fracturing, confirmed the parameters of integral fracturing of coal seam in this thesis. Considering the block specific circumstances of Hancheng, Baode, Daning-Jixian, depending on the production of coal seam permeability and different pressure, gave an integral fracturing program of seam fracturing to simulate, completed the optimization of fracturing program, achieved the matching of artificial fracture and well network of development, this thesis recommended to adapt the overall development plan seam fracturing fracturing wells existing network, and also gave the optimal solutions and adapt well fracturing network.
